An implementation of DSDIFF metadata /*! * This is an implementation of DSDIFF metadata. * * This supports an ID3v2 tag as well as reading stream from the ID3 RIFF * chunk as well as properties from the file. * Description of the DSDIFF format is available at * * DSDIFF_1.5_Spec.pdf. * The DSDIFF standard does not explicitly specify the ID3 chunk. * It can be found at the root level, but also sometimes inside the PROP chunk. * In addition, title and artist info are stored as part of the standard. */ namespace DSDIFF { //!
